Hi Mohammed Samir,

Please let me know the blue screen error code. In addition try running the hardware diagnostics by tapping the F12 key on a few times during startup until you see the ‘One Time Boot Menu’ appear.

At the one time boot menu, press the down arrow key to highlight ‘Diagnostics’, and then press Enter to begin the hardware diagnostics.

If the test fails, please make a note of any error codes listed. You can also refer to the link below.
